Linux 에서 sqlplus 를 sys 로 로그인 후 오라클을 시작하고 종료하는 명령어를 확인해보자.

원도우에 설치된 오라클도 마찬가지로 시작하고 종료할 수 있다.



4가지 경우의 수로 로그인하는데 - 1), 2)가 안될 수도 있음

1) Sqlplus 를 sys 계정으로 시작하기

2) Sqlplus 를 시작하고, sys 계정으로 로그인하기

3) Sqlplus 를 시작하고, sys 계정으로 로그인하기 - 패스워드 입력

4) Sqlplus 를 로그인 없이 접속하고, sys 계정으로 연결하기 - 비밀번호가 노출되므로 주의해야한다.


1), 2)는 sys 패스워드 없이

3), 4)는 sys 패스워드를 입력하고 로그인 한다.


1) Sqlplus 를 sys 계정으로 시작하기

[oracle@centosme ~]$ sqlplus / as sysdba
SQL*Plus: Release Production on Sun Jan 19 04:54:57 2020
Copyright (c) 1982, 2009, Oracle.  All rights reserved.
Connected to an idle instance.


2) Sqlplus 를 시작하고, sys 계정으로 로그인하기

[oracle@centosme ~]$ sqlplus
SQL*Plus: Release Production on Sun Jan 19 04:57:20 2020
Copyright (c) 1982, 2009, Oracle.  All rights reserved.
Enter user-name: / as sysdba
Connected to an idle instance.


3) Sqlplus 를 시작하고, sys 계정으로 로그인하기 - 패스워드 입력

[oracle@centosme ~]$ sqlplus
SQL*Plus: Release Production on Sun Jan 19 05:09:28 2020
Copyright (c) 1982, 2009, Oracle.  All rights reserved.
Enter user-name: sys /as sysdba
Enter password: password
Connected to an idle instance.

4) Sqlplus 를 로그인 없이 접속하고, sys 계정으로 연결하기 - 비밀번호가 노출되므로 주의해야한다.

# sqlplus 접속 - /nolog

[oracle@centosme ~]$ sqlplus /nolog
SQL*Plus: Release Production on Sun Jan 19 03:10:38 2020
Copyright (c) 1982, 2009, Oracle.  All rights reserved.

# sys 계정으로 연결
SQL> conn sys/password as sysdba
Connected to an idle instance.




오라클 공식 문서

Database 2 Day DBA

  Getting Started with Database Administration

    sqlplus 로 검색 하고 확인

      To start SQL*Plus and connect to the database from the command line:

      To start SQL*Plus and connect to the database from the Windows Start menu:



# 오라클 사용자 확인
SQL> show user;


# 오라클 시작

SQL> startup 
ORACLE instance started.

Total System Global Area 1603411968 bytes
Fixed Size                               2213776 bytes
Variable Size                      1107298416 bytes
Database Buffers               486539264 bytes
Redo Buffers                          7360512 bytes
Database mounted.
Database opened.


# 다른 터미널(Terminal)을 열어서 오라클서버가 시작했는지 확인

[oracle@centosme ~]$ ps -ef | grep ora_
oracle    3532     1  0 04:28 ?        00:00:00 ora_pmon_MYDB
oracle    3534     1  0 04:28 ?        00:00:00 ora_vktm_MYDB
oracle    3538     1  0 04:28 ?        00:00:00 ora_gen0_MYDB


# 오라클 종료

SQL> shutdown immediate
Database closed.
Database dismounted.
ORACLE instance shut down.




리눅스 버전확인 - 아래 링크

[Linux] Linux 버전(version) 확인하기


+ Recent posts